Already known as one of the world’s largest RFID antenna producers, HUAYUAN is planning another expansion of its production capacities. The company has announced its plans to open new production bases in Jiangxi, China for the manufacture of a new generation of aluminum antennas by spring 2024. Production waste will be reduced by 98 percent at the new production bases.

Full Scale Production Planned for Q3 in 2024
A new RFID antenna and inlay manufacturing facility is currently under construction in Jiangxi, China. The new facility will employ 150 staff members and the production of the new aluminum antennas is planned to start in spring 2024. By the third quarter of 2024, the new antennas will be in full scale production. The new production base includes 39 production lines with a capacity of 60 million square meters.Here, approximately 30 billion RFID inlays will be produced. With the scale of production, antenna costs are also predicted to be reduced by 30 percent.
The Next Generation of Aluminum Antennas
What makes HUAYUAN’s new generation of aluminum antennas so special?
- Breaking the barrier of existing antenna accuracies to accommodate ever-smaller chip sizes. Accuracy will be increased by 50 percent and the line width & line spacing will measure 75um.
- With an advanced environmental protection treatment system and in cooperation with a top scientific institute in environment protection technology, manufacturing waste at the new production plant will be reduced by 98 %.
- Production methods of the aluminum antenna include etching, mechanical die-cutting and laser die-cutting with optional substrates like paper, fabric and PET.
